The FAA amends § 39.13 by adding the following new airworthiness directive: 2026–15–07 Pilatus Aircraft Ltd.: Amendment 39–23419; Docket No. FAA–2026–0015; Project Identifier MCAI–2025–01528–A. (a) Effective Date This airworthiness directive (AD) is effective September 3, 2026. (b) Affected ADs None. (c) Applicability This AD applies to Pilatus Aircraft Ltd Model PC–12/47E airplanes, manufacturer serial numbers 1720 and 2001 through 2999, certificated in any category. (d) Subject Joint Aircraft System Component (JASC) Code 7720, Engine Temp. Indicating System. (e) Unsafe Condition This AD was prompted by a report that during an engine start on the ground, the airplane battery voltage dropped to a value that resulted in an avionic system shutdown. The FAA is issuing this AD to prevent takeoff when an undetected interstage turbine temperature exceedance occurs during engine start. The unsafe condition, if not addressed, could result in reduced turbine blade structural integrity with possible engine failure and loss of thrust. SUPPLEMENTARY INFORMATION : Background The FAA issued a notice of proposed rulemaking (NPRM) to amend 14 CFR part 39 by adding an AD that would apply to certain Bombardier, Inc. Model BD–700–1A10, BD–700–1A11 airplanes. The NPRM was published in the Federal Register on April 23, 2026 (91 FR 21747). The NPRM was prompted by Transport Canada AD CF–2022–53, dated September 8, 2022 (Transport Canada AD CF–2022–53) (also referred to as the MCAI), issued by Transport Canada, which is the aviation authority for Canada. The MCAI states an in- service event occurred where a main landing gear tire burst upon landing. The investigation into the event found that with the loss of a 5V power supply in the BCU wheel control card, a residual current may build within the brake control valve (BCV) driver circuit. This residual current may result in uncommanded brake pressure during landing. If not corrected, this can cause one or more tires to burst due to a dragging brake or a locked brake, unexpected deceleration, degraded braking performance, directional difficulties, or brake(s) overheating. In the NPRM, the FAA proposed to require an inspection to determine if an affected BCU is installed, replacement of affected BCUs, and prohibit the installation of affected parts, as specified in Transport Canada AD CF– 2022–53. The FAA is issuing this AD to address the unsafe condition on these products. You may examine the MCAI in the AD docket at regulations.gov under Docket No. FAA–2026–3864. Discussion of Final Airworthiness Directive Comments The FAA received a comment from NetJets Aviation. The following presents the comment received on the NPRM and the FAA’s response to the comment. Request To Allow the Use of Maintenance Records NetJets Aviation requested that the FAA revise the proposed AD to allow logbook research as an acceptable method of compliance for Part I, ‘‘Verification of Installed Parts,’’ of Transport Canada AD CF–2022–53. NetJets Aviation stated that determining whether BCU part number GW415– 7125–7 is installed can be reliably accomplished through review of aircraft maintenance records and component installation history when documentation is complete and traceable, without requiring a physical inspection. NetJets Aviation also stated that allowing this approach would reduce unnecessary maintenance burden while maintaining an equivalent level of safety. The FAA agrees. The FAA has determined that a review of airplane maintenance records is acceptable in lieu of the inspection to determine the BCU part number, provided the BCU part number can be conclusively determined from that review. The FAA has added an exception to paragraph (h)(2) of this AD accordingly. Material Incorporated by Reference Under 1 CFR Part 51 Transport Canada AD CF–2022–53 specifies procedures for an inspection to determine if BCUs with part number (P/ N) GW415–7125–7 (Crane P/N 42–965– 3) are installed and replacement of affected parts with BCU P/N GW415– 7125–9 (Crane P/N 42–965–4). Transport Canada AD CF–2022–53 also prohibits the installation of affected parts. The FAA amends § 39.13 by adding the following new airworthiness directive: 2026–15–09 Bombardier, Inc.: Amendment 39–23421; Docket No. FAA–2026–3864; Project Identifier MCAI–2022–01215–T. (a) Effective Date This airworthiness directive (AD) is effective September 3, 2026. (b) Affected ADs None. (c) Applicability This AD applies to Bombardier, Inc. Model BD–700–1A10 and BD–700–1A11 airplanes, certificated in any category, as identified in Transport Canada AD CF–2022–53, dated September 8, 2022 (Transport Canada AD CF–2022–53). (d) Subject Air Transport Association (ATA) of America Code 32, Landing Gear. (e) Unsafe Condition This AD was prompted by an in-service event where a main landing gear tire burst upon landing. The investigation into the event found that with the loss of a 5V power supply in the brake control unit (BCU) wheel control card, a residual current may build within the brake control valve (BCV) driver circuit. This residual current may result in uncommanded brake pressure during landing. The unsafe condition, if not addressed, could result in one or more tires to burst due to a dragging brake or a locked brake, unexpected deceleration, degraded braking performance, directional difficulties, or brake(s) overheating. (f) Compliance Comply with this AD within the compliance times specified, unless already done. (g) Requirements Except as specified in paragraphs (h) and (i) of this AD: Comply with all required actions and compliance times specified in, and in accordance with, Transport Canada AD CF–2022–53. (h) Exception to Transport Canada AD CF– 2022–53 (1) Where Transport Canada AD CF–2022– 53 refers to its effective date, this AD requires using the effective date of this AD. (2) Where Part I, ‘‘Verification of Installed Parts’’, of Transport Canada AD CF–2022–53 specifies to inspect whether BCU part number (P/N) GW415–7125–7 (Crane P/N 42–965–3) is installed, for this AD, a review of airplane maintenance records is acceptable in lieu of the inspection, provided the BCU part number can be conclusively determined from that review. (i) No Reporting Requirement and No Return of Parts Although the material referenced in Transport Canada AD CF–2022–53 specifies to submit certain information and return parts to the manufacturer, this AD does not include those requirements. SUPPLEMENTARY INFORMATION : Background The FAA issued a notice of proposed rulemaking (NPRM) to amend 14 CFR part 39 by adding an AD that would apply to all Leonardo S.p.a. Model AW189 helicopters. The NPRM was published in the Federal Register on April 29, 2026 (91 FR 23031). The NPRM was prompted by EASA AD 2025–0064, dated March 25, 2025 (EASA AD 2025–0064) (also referred to as the MCAI), issued by EASA, which is the Technical Agent for the Member States of the European Union. The MCAI states that there have been reports of cracking on ejector duct part number (P/N) 8G7810P00131 (LH side) and P/N 8G7810P00231 (RH side) of the rear sliding cowling, where the engine exhaust ducts are installed. The MCAI also states that investigation of the cracks, which developed around the engine exhaust duct boundary reinforcement plate, is ongoing to identify the root cause of the occurrences, and the inspection area needs to be extended to the area of the exhaust bracket reinforcements. Additionally, the MCAI states that, due to reasons still under investigation, any Leonardo S.p.a. Model AW189 helicopter having manufacturer serial number 49018, 49019, 49025, or 49028 is subject to shorter compliance times due to higher likelihood of cracking. This condition, if not detected and corrected, could lead to detachment of a part of the ejector duct, which could impact the helicopter tailplane or the tail rotor with consequent loss of control of the helicopter. In the NPRM, the FAA proposed to require repetitively inspecting the LH side and RH side ejector ducts, including the exhaust bracket reinforcements and reinforcement plates, and, depending on the results, replacing any affected ejector duct. The FAA is issuing this AD to address the unsafe condition on these products.
